Day 01: - Arrival Jaipur
Arrival Jaipur Airport, met & transferred to hotel. (O/n at Jaipur)
Day 02: - Jaipur Sightseeing
After breakfast at hotel, proceed to visit Jaipur City which includes visit of Amber Fort with the joyride of Elephant, City Palace, Jantar Mantar, Hawa Mahal, Birla Temple, Local Market. (O/n at Jaipur)
Day 03: - Drive Jaipur - Jodhpur via Pushkar
After breakfast at hotel, drive from Jaipur to Jodhpur & on the way visit of Pushkar City which includes visit of Pushkar Lake, Brahma Temple. Arrival Jodhpur & check in into hotel. (O/n at Jodhpur)
Day 04: - Am Jodhpur Sightseeing + Drive Udaipur
After breakfast at hotel, proceed to visit Jodhpur city which includes visit of Ummed Bhawan, Mehrangarh Fort, Jaswant Thada, Clock Tower, Sadar Bazar, Mandore Garden & later drive Udaipur on the way visit of Ranakpur Jain Temples. Arrival Udaipur & check in into hotel. (O/n at Udaipur)
Day 05: - Udaipur Sightseeing
After breakfast at hotel, proceed to visit Udaipur City which includes visit of City Palace, Crystal Museum, Lake Pichola, Jag Mandir, Saheliyon Ki Bari, Fateh Sagar Lake, Shilpgram. (O/n at Udaipur)
Day 06: - Departure Transfer
After breakfast at hotel, met & transferred to Udaipur Airport to board the further destination flight.
End of the Tour
Jaipur, the capital of Rajasthan, is a vibrant city known for its rich history, stunning architecture, and colorful culture. As the first planned city of India, it offers a unique blend of traditional Rajasthani heritage and modern amenities, making it a must-visit destination for travelers.
Amber Fort is a majestic fort located on a hilltop overlooking Maota Lake. It is known for its stunning architecture, intricate carvings, and historical significance.
Hawa Mahal, or the Palace of Winds, is a five-story pyramidal structure made of red and pink sandstone. It is famous for its intricate latticework and unique architecture.
City Palace is a complex of courtyards, gardens, and buildings that served as the seat of the Maharaja of Jaipur. It is known for its stunning architecture and rich history.
Jantar Mantar is a collection of architectural astronomical instruments built by Maharaja Sawai Jai Singh II. It is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and a testament to India's rich scientific heritage.
Nahargarh Fort is a majestic fort located on the edge of the Aravalli Hills. It offers panoramic views of the city and is known for its historical significance and architectural beauty.
